The majority of the receipts are electronic (not a scan of paper) and the system cant reliable parse electronics receipts from Home Depot. Additionally I uploaded over 600 receipts and only about 10% was automatically matched using the receipt manager. I can do 100 receipts from email or a cloud drive in the time it takes to do about 25. The receipt manager app was clearly not designed with a bookkeeper or accountant involved as the competing process of scanning a receipt to email or using "Office Lens" or similar app to capture receipts to your phone and cloud storage is about four times as fast as using the receipt manager. Additionally the receipt scanner cannot process return receipts so if an item is returned which is normal from job to job your mapping the receipt manually. Example a transaction for fuel is entered in the system but set to "Automobile Expense" but now the user trying to enter the receipt try to match it as "Automobile Expense-Fuel" the receipt wont match even though the date, amount, and vendor are correct. This process is faster than using the receipt manager as the receipt manager still requires you to load the vendor center and then manually hunt down the transaction because the receipt requires to many identification points to match a transaction.
